## Key Ceremony — Item 3: FD-Hunt Tooling Key

Confirm the signing key for the Pondermill descriptor-leak tracer was cut on the ceremony machine. Old key revoked; new fingerprint logged. Maintainers: the tracer refuses unsigned builds, so keep escrow current. Unsealing escrow requires the phrase recorded below.

vault phrase of bagaf-kajeg = jorath-feniel-briir-siliel-ralix

# Heads up, release crew: this env file covers the new Accountry
# service we carved out of the Bramblewood monolith's user module.
# Session handling still round-trips through the old monolith until
# phase 3, so both services must agree on the signing credential or
# logins will bounce between them endlessly. Keep this file in sync
# with the monolith's copy. The next line sets that shared secret.

env line for fafof-fahag: LEDGER_TOKEN5=f8790

Q3 Planning Note — Finance Team

Effective the start of Q3, Marlowe Goods will transition fulfilment from Bexley Freight to Corvid Logistics. Contract rates are roughly 8% lower per consignment, with fuel surcharges capped through year-end. Expect a one-off migration cost of about 40k, booked in July. Invoicing moves to monthly consolidated billing, so accruals will need adjusting. Please update vendor records and forecast templates accordingly. The rationale behind the switch is summarised in the confidential note below.

management briefing: The pricing group signed off on a budget of $378.8 million for Project Kasael.

**Q: The Textweld upload service flagged a batch of files as "encoding undetermined" — what do I do?**

A: This usually means the Glyphsift detector hit mixed byte sequences it can't classify with confidence, often from files exported by the legacy Quillmark editor. Do not force UTF-8 re-encoding; that corrupts the originals. Instead, move the batch to the quarantine bucket and rerun detection with the strict flag disabled. To unlock the quarantine bucket's recovery console, authenticate with the passphrase below.

recovery phrase for yawep-bagaf: ralax-silwyn-sorius